Transaction 07ef640ad4cd84af18f069188b55c7998979b087e04a0907b67d86a0c79bed17

1 Input
2 Outputs
  • 07ef640ad4cd84af18f069188b55c7998979b087e04a0907b67d86a0c79bed17:0
  • value  1578009
    address  12huSxFtv6ciah5i1Na4Xu6tQF47hgQNtY
  • 07ef640ad4cd84af18f069188b55c7998979b087e04a0907b67d86a0c79bed17:1
  • value  1753968
    address  3Mnie4D6Hsjp8zxLjnCtU58aMRkY6gQzgw